Regina Savago Obituary

Regina Elizabeth Savago, a resident of Baton Rouge and native of Kingston, NY, passed away Thursday evening, November 15, 2012 at Ollie Steele Burden Manor. Born August 2, 1924 to Clarence and Elizabeth Robertson, she received a nursing degree at the Benedictine Hospital in Kingston, NY in 1943. It was her honor to care for many injured soldiers who had returned home from World War II. She met her husband of 63 years, 2nd Lt. U.S. Army Air Force Officer Joseph Savago, during that time, when he came to her home to pay his respects to her parents for the loss of their son, John Robertson, one of his Air Force colleagues. Over the course of their life together, they resided in Franklin Square, NY, South Salem, NY, Dennis, MA, Deland, FL, and Baton Rouge, LA. She is survived by her daughter, Kathleen Smith and husband Alvin, granddaughters Rachel and Hannah Smith, and several nieces and nephews. She was preceded in death by her husband, Joseph Savago, her son, Joseph Savago, Jr., and siblings John, Patricia, and William. The family would like to express their deep appreciation to the staff at the St. Elizabeth Wing of Ollie Steele Burden Manor and The Hospice of Baton Rouge for the exquisite care they gave to Regina during the last season of her life. Visitation will be held Monday, November 19 at Greenoaks Funeral Home, Baton Rouge, from 1 to 2 p.m., followed by Mass at 2 p.m. Interment will be at Greenoaks Cemetery.
